AnonD-531620, 28 Oct 2016I can't understand the reviews either, they are so contradi... moreEven I was in ur situation a week back , confused if it will be a good phone as many says its a failure for lg ...
I considered getting honor 8 , as it possessed good features too...but still other honor phones weren't great sound in the reviews !
So who would miss a snapdragon 820, dual SIM ,colour pink , dual camera with good quality photos ... All these as per review from websites ....and this phone was way cheaper than s7, htc 10 , iPhone 6s which has same features ...
So some how convinced myself to get this phone ...
Its a been a week as I said
Its a nice phone
Very speedy ... Runs all apps and games smoothly ...
Display is good only ... Like may be not that nice as s7 and it has to be 100% if u use it in outdoors ... Indoors 18% would do ...
Cameras are great ... No complaints
Yea only thing that little disappoints with this phone is battery life ...
If it charges to 100% ... U will expect a solid 4 hours usuage only ..in outdoors 4 hours usage in battery saving mode ... I use full time 4g and notifications ... If u turn on VPN or location or sync , be ready to loose more of ur battery ...
But once u plug in ...it charges solo quick ...15% to 98% in 25 mins
It has other features like NFC , IR
So if u can manage battery life efficiently
This phone is a great phone for u
This phone was called failure bcuz of the price it was initially sold ... But now for the reduced price ... It bcums a best buy .
Have fun with ur new lg g5 ... Its really nice !!
